Location and Setting

The Magic Robin Hood show is set within a medieval-style venue designed to evoke a castle or forest, complete with banners, shields, and period decorations. This scenic setup helps deepen your immersion into Robin Hood’s world, making it more than just a theatrical performance. Given its location in the Valencian Community, it offers a fun escape from typical beach days and into a world of legend and lore.

The Itinerary: What to Expect

The evening begins with a warm welcome and seating, offering choices for different packages. The standard dinner includes hearty appetizers like potato chips, nachos, assorted sodas, and a soup of cream of mushrooms. The main course features roasted chicken with potatoes, grilled vegetables, and corn on the cob, served in a casual, hands-on style that echoes medieval dining (think eating with your fingers).

Those opting for the VIP pass get a more elaborate meal—snacks, vegetable soup, roast chicken, chicken skewer, roast pork ribs, and an array of vegetables and bread—plus alcoholic beverages like beer and sangria, included in the price. The desserts are simple but satisfying, with ice cream providing a sweet finish.

The Show: Robin Hood Comes to Life

Once seated, the performance begins with a proclamation of John Landless as King and a narrative that introduces the Robin Hood legend. The show’s pacing is lively, with sword fights, jousting, and horse stunts that entertain both children and adults alike. The cast performs with humor and skill, and the show often involves the audience, making everyone feel part of the story.

Reviews highlight how engaging the cast is—Gayle said her sister and nephew “absolutely loved it” and appreciated being involved in the action. Rachel noted that the front-row seats and opportunities to meet the cast and animals added a special touch that made the experience memorable.

Practical Considerations

Since the show is a 1.5-hour performance, it fits well into an evening plan without feeling too long or rushed. Check availability for starting times in advance, as they vary. Keep in mind that transportation might be an issue if you don’t have a car, as the venue isn’t in the heart of Benidorm’s tourist area. This could mean arranging a taxi or private ride, which is worth factoring into your plans.

The language of the show alternates between English and Spanish, which adds authenticity but could be confusing for some. However, the physical comedy and visual elements make up for potential language gaps.

Is the show suitable for children?
Yes, many reviews mention children having a fantastic time, especially due to the involvement of the cast and the engaging story.

What is included in the standard ticket?
Your ticket covers entry to the show and a medieval-style dinner, including appetizers, a main course of roasted chicken, vegetables, and dessert, plus soft drinks.

What does the VIP package include?
The VIP pass offers front-row seats, the opportunity to meet the cast and animals, a more extensive meal with additional options like ribs and skewers, and alcoholic beverages.

Are drinks included in the standard ticket?
No, drinks are available at the open bar only if you purchase the VIP package.

How long does the experience last?
The show lasts approximately 1.5 hours, making it a perfect evening activity.

Is transportation to the venue easy?
Transportation might require a taxi or private car, as the venue is not in the central tourist areas of Benidorm.

Is there a language barrier?
The show alternates between English and Spanish, so some familiarity with either language helps, but the physical humor and visuals make it accessible to all.

Can I cancel my ticket?
Yes, cancellation is free if done up to 1 day and 12 hours before the scheduled time.
